Market Equilibrium

A state where the supply of a product matches its demand, resulting in stable prices.

Quantity Demanded

The aggregate quantity of a product or service that buyers are prepared to buy at a given price.

Excess Supply

A situation where the quantity of a product offered for sale by producers exceeds the quantity that consumers are willing to buy at a given price.

Quantity Supplied

The total amount of a specific good or service that producers are willing and able to sell at a particular price over a given period of time.
